Supreme Lending Senior Editor Salary

The average Supreme Lending Senior Editor earns an estimated $79,797 annually. Supreme Lending's Senior Editor compensation is $6,090 more than the US average for a Senior Editor.

The Communications Department at Supreme Lending earns $6,800 more on average than the Enterprise Risk Department.
